Do you love it? I love it. One of the biggest changes you'll notice is my pricing. Before when I was offering various hours, it was getting kind of awkward. You see, if a couple hired me for X amount of hours and then the day started to run behind (as wedding days tend to do), about 30 minutes before the reception was supposed to end a lot of times the couple still hadn't cut the cake, thrown the bouquet or done any dancing. I'd approach the couple or their parents, tell them I was leaving in 30 minutes and they'd either cram everything in or just say, "oh well, I guess." I hated that. Hated being the bad guy and dictating the flow of their day. Now, I'm yours for all the day's festivities. From the getting ready at the salon to the big send-off, I'll be there for however much (or little) you need me.

You'll also notice that all the packages include complimentary engagements and bridals. I cannot stress how important it is to have the same photographer for your engagements, bridals and wedding day. It's how we get to know each other, it keeps a consistent style. Shooting the wedding day without shooting engagements and bridals is a little bit like taking the final exam without studying.
